Grief is hard.
Healing together can help.
Our free, four-week program is designed to support school-age children (K-12) and their caregivers in Sioux Falls and the surrounding area as they process grief in a safe, welcoming, and compassionate environment.
What to Expect
Each session begins with a shared meal—giving families a chance to connect and feel at ease. After eating, participants break into age-based groups led by experienced counselors and social workers:
Children’s group
Teen/adolescent group
Adult/caregiver group
Childcare for infants, toddlers, and preschoolers
Our program is non-religious and open to all backgrounds and belief systems.
